-module(nova_audit_pgo).
-moduledoc """
pgo-backed adapter for `nova_audit`.

Writes events directly to a Postgres table via `pgo`, bypassing any ORM
layer. Useful for apps that already use pgo (or want to) and don't want
Kura as a transitive dependency.

## Configuration

```erlang
#{
adapter => nova_audit_pgo,
pool => default,
table => <<"audit_events">>
}
```

The `pgo` pool must be started by the application; this adapter does NOT
manage pool lifecycle.

## Schema

Uses the same table shape as `nova_audit_kura`. See
`nova_audit_pgo:schema_sql/0` (identical to `nova_audit_kura:schema_sql/0`).

## Hardening

After applying the schema, REVOKE UPDATE and DELETE on the audit table
for your application role. See `nova_audit_pgo:hardening_sql/0` or use
the Kura adapter's helper interchangeably.

## pg_types configuration

For UUIDv7 round-tripping through pgo, configure `pg_types` with
`uuid_format=string` at startup so `event_id` arrives as a binary on
both write and read paths.
""".
